Abstract
A method and/or system for query expansion may include: providing a set of training data in a given domain in the form of training question texts and training answer texts, identifying disjoint answer words in the training answer text that do not occur in the associated training question text, generating a graph of question word nodes and answer word nodes generated from the set of training data for the given domain in the form of the training question texts and the training answer texts, wherein edges are provided between a disjoint pair of a question word node for a question word in a training question and an answer word node for a disjoint answer word in an associated training answer, and applying spreading activation through the graph to result in a top n most highly activated nodes that are used as candidate words for expansion of a user query input.
